The Role

The Clinical Research Manager combines the responsibilities of supporting the coordination of clinical trials along with leading and overseeing the research department.   This role requires strong leadership skills to guide and mentor staff, provide strategic direction, manage resources, and foster a collaborative environment to achieve research objectives.  The Clinical Research Manager ensures that all studies are conducted in compliance with regulatory requirements and protocols, and that data is accurately collected and reported.
